Arteria with Gallery 23 is owned by Jane Richardson who won the Business Rocks Business Woman of the Year award for 2008. The annual event, organised by our very own Chamber of Commerce along with Bay Business Centre, Business Link and Rotaract, recognises local businesses which are making a difference to our city. Jane’s achievement is particularly impressive in that her business is just 4 ½ years old and she began it at the relatively young age of 25. In that time she and her team have made the Arteria shop, which sells design-led gifts, and the contemporary art gallery upstairs, one of Lancaster’s most respected shops.

It’s a new year and Arteria with Gallery 23 is off to a flying start with an inspiring showcase of talent from The Art & Craft Guild of Lancashire.
The Guild was established in 1986 to provide support to professional artists, designers and makers. The Gallery 23 exhibition promises to be truly special as the members of the Guild are selected as such for their “qualities of originality and excellence in their work and design”
The credible artists, some of which are award winning, exhibit across the UK. The Lancashire based Guild to be showing at the Lancaster based gallery is an event that Managing Director Jane Richardson feels is an important one:
“We at Arteria are so proud to be presenting the work of The Art & Crafts Guild. It gives us great pleasure to champion such high quality local talent.”
Indeed the Guild itself believes this collaboration is a positive move for the creative profile of the North West and is enthusiastic about the Guilds achievements and members as Jane Bell, Chair of The Guild explains:
“The Art and Craft Guild of Lancashire has been in existence for nearly 25 years. running as a co-operative .The Guild seeks out artists and designer/makers who create imaginative art and make unique objects encompassing textiles, jewellery, ceramics, wood and glass. There are a wide range of desirable pieces to satisfy all price ranges. We are very pleased to be exhibiting at Arteria where we have had several successful shows in the past. Lancaster is extremely fortunate to have a such a gallery who continually seek out new makers producing innovative articles."
